In order to keep these arteries healthy, engineers use a very specialized internal diagnostic instrument known as caliper pigging. This device is not like regular cleaning tools, which only scrape the walls; instead, it has an advanced set of mechanical fingers or electronic sensors to scan the internal diameter of the pipe in three dimensions. Since it moves along the line, carried away by the stream of the product or compressed air, it captures all the microscopic variations in the geometry of the steel. The very process of caliper pigging implementation is a piece of logistry and physics. Suppose you were to start off with a high-tech probe into a dark pressurized tunnel spanning fifty miles long. The machine should be tough to withstand the huge forces but still sensitive enough to read the dent as thin as a fingernail. This pre-construction survey is important at the post-construction stage. It establishes that the pipeline has been laid properly and there are no buckles that have been made in the course of the backfilling. In case a contractor drops a huge rock accidentally on the pipe before burying it, it will be getting detected by its geometry scan and a repair will be taken prior to the line being commissioned at all. When the device comes out of the receiving trap, the actual work commences. The raw data is an incoherent flow of measurements which needs to be converted into a graphical representation of the pipe. The noise of the weld beads and valves are filtered off using specialized software which then marks the actual anomalies. This meaning is a form of art. It demands the attention of an engineer to check a data spike and decide whether it is a benign manufacturing error or an essential dent that has to be excavated at once.
